Capturing the Bond: Father and Baby Figures

The Father’s Presence

Drawing a father with his baby is all about capturing the connection and warmth between them. Start by sketching out the father’s overall figure, paying attention to his posture and expression. Consider whether he is cradling the baby in his arms, holding them close, or simply sitting beside them.

The Baby’s Expression and Pose

The baby’s expression and pose are crucial for conveying the father-baby relationship. Observe and study images of fathers with babies to understand their natural interactions. Pay attention to the way they gaze at each other, smile, or snuggle. Incorporate these details into your drawing to evoke the emotional connection between them.

Realistic Details: Father and Baby Features

The Father’s Facial Features

Drawing a father’s facial features accurately is essential for capturing his personality and emotions. Study the lines and angles of his face, paying attention to the shape of his eyes, nose, and mouth. Consider the father’s age, ethnicity, and any distinctive features that make him unique.

The Baby’s Delicate Features

Drawing a baby’s features requires attention to detail and a gentle touch. Start by sketching out the baby’s round head and chubby cheeks. Capture the softness of their skin, the tiny folds, and the delicate lines around their eyes and mouth. Use subtle shading to create depth and realism.

Composition and Perspective: Bringing it to Life

Father-Baby Interactions

Compose your drawing to highlight the interaction between the father and baby. Consider the perspective from which you want to draw, whether it’s a close-up capturing their intimate bond or a wider angle showcasing their playful moments.

Background and Setting

The background and setting can enhance the overall narrative of your drawing. Choose a setting that complements the father-baby relationship, such as a cozy armchair, a grassy field, or a bustling park. Use light and shadow to create depth and atmosphere.

4. What are some tips for drawing fathers with babies?

Here are a few tips for drawing fathers with babies:

  • Start by sketching the basic shapes of the father and baby’s bodies.
  • Pay attention to the proportions of the bodies and the way they interact with each other.
  • Use light, flowing lines to create a sense of movement and emotion.
  • Add details to the father and baby’s clothing and surroundings.

5. What are some common poses for fathers with babies?

Some common poses for fathers with babies include:

  • The father holding the baby in his arms
  • The father sitting with the baby on his lap
  • The father playing with the baby
  • The father and baby sleeping together

8. What are some mistakes to avoid when drawing fathers with babies?

Here are a few mistakes to avoid when drawing fathers with babies:

  • Drawing the father or baby too stiffly or awkwardly
  • Not paying attention to the proportions of the bodies
  • Not capturing the emotion or relationship between the father and baby

9. How can I practice drawing fathers with babies?

The best way to practice drawing fathers with babies is to draw from life. If you have access to a father and baby, ask them to pose for you. You can also find photos or videos of fathers with babies online and use them as references.
